用户规格说明书
用户规格说明书
1、作业链接https://edu.cnblogs.com/campus/fzzcxy/2016SE/homework/2180
2 、原型链接 https://modao.cc/app/vbgngpHzG7fhvtx60eU7LeT4cMymhbL
学号1:334
学号2:315
一、引言
编写目的
- 明确小学算术题目生成项目的详细需求,供用户使用项目的功能和性能,进一步详细设计完善软件,使用户有更好的出题体验
项目背景
- 项目名称:小学加减乘除出题
- 面向用户:小学家长
- 开发者:至诚学院16级软工小组
参考资料
- 构建之法
二、总体描述
开发背景
- 老师,家长想有一个可以自动生成题目的程序,并希望可以自定义参数
开发意图
- 手工出题劳动量太过枯燥,为了方便广大小学数学教师,家长,针对小学生群体进行了需求设计
应用目标及范围
- 小学数学教师,小学生及其家长
产品前景
- 满足小学数学老师的出题要求
用户场景分析
- 下面针对我们的系统主要面向的三类用户:
- 出试卷给小学生们做测验
- 出计算题作业给小学生
- 给家长体验出题
根据需求分析文档,我们基本可以归纳出以下三种用户的典型用户
用户 | 王老师 |
---|---|
性别 | 男 |
年龄 | 28 |
职业 | 小学数学教师 |
动机 | 出题繁琐枯燥 |
目的 | 使学生得到训练 |
典型场景 | 课后布置作业 |
用户 | 家长 |
---|---|
性别 | 男 |
年龄 | 30 |
职业 | 公司职员 |
动机 | 没空实时准备作业给孩子做 |
目的 | 使孩子得到训练 |
典型场景 | 课后练习作业 |
用户 | 小学生 |
---|---|
性别 | 男 |
年龄 | 8 |
职业 | 学生 |
动机 | 想加强训练 |
目的 | 算术能力得到提高 |
典型场景 | 周末闲暇时间 |
用户需求
下面我们通过分析典型用户场景得出各位用户的需求:
- 对于没有使用过的用户,可以自己根据需求出题的类型及数量
- 对于想出几个题目作为作业的用户,可以根据自己的需求使用
- 对于想出试卷的用户,可以根据自己的需求使用
运行环境
- 安卓
假设与限制
- 开发人员不变以及开发人员不会经历各种不可抗力导致的重大变动
- Deadline不提前
- 需求不变
- 团队成员均为大三,人数少
- 本项目为新项目,没有之前团队留下的基础
- 小组成员首次合作,需要一个磨合过程
- 所有小组成员之前都没有类似开发经验
- 本次开发周期很短,时间紧张
- 开发期间的其他学习任务,将很大程度上影响开发进度
三、界面原型
首页进入app界面
注册或登录
注册界面
注册成功界面
准备出题界面
题目类型选择界面
题目生成界面
题目及答案生成界面
一些不足
- 功能简单,代码不够健壮
- 界面不够美观,较简陋
- 部分功能未能全部实现